Output 85ac537aab546c87e6d1ced5c96289500f5f8c0d8608f0f7e4e0cce691ef8eee:2

value
32300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cfc82d74e18be43d7023d174b276da0a2a9c88c OP_EQUAL
address
3D5tD7JDFV3wYABKHnyD5EFcLccHsz6CU2
transaction
85ac537aab546c87e6d1ced5c96289500f5f8c0d8608f0f7e4e0cce691ef8eee
confirmations
340596
spent
true